Is it safe to put PS4 on glass?

It doesn't matter whether you put your PS4 on glass, wood, marble, brick, linoleum tiling, or whatever other random material you can think of. What's more important is keeping the space on the sides and back of the console open so it can properly vent the heat out. Avoid cabinet style TV stands and you'll be good.

Does the bottom of a PS4 get hot?

It will only get hot IF the air-flow is obstructed in some way. Like putting the console in a closed environment or to close to the wall. In PS4 the heat from the console comes out from the back like an exhaust port.

Is it safe to use a PS4 without a cover?

Looking at the teardown, there is no actual "harm" removing the bottom cover. The airflow is redirected toward the back by the bottom cover as the fan blows downward. If you do remove the bottom cover, the PS4 should be vertical, and you would need to be incredibly careful not to damage those cables.

How hot should a PS4 get?

Sony recommends only using the PS4 in environments where the temperature is between 41 and 95 degrees Fahrenheit, with a narrower range of 50 to 80 degrees being preferred. If your room is hotter than 80 degrees, that may lead to your PS4 overheating.

Will a ps4 break if it gets wet?

Water or any liquid (except distilled water) and electronics and electricity are not a good mix. The impurities in the liquid causes corrosion and provides circuit paths for the electricity which were not in the console's operating design and could damage the components.

How can you tell if your ps4 is overheating?

If a console (PS4 or Xbox) is actually overheating, it will show an overheating warning on the screen and shut itself down. If it does not show an overheating warning, then it's probably not overheating.
